Avenue of the Blessed Virgin Mary

Highlight • Structure

Aleja Najświętszej Maryi Panny (often abbreviated as Al. NMP or Aleje) - a street in Częstochowa, which is the main, representative communication artery of the city center. The avenue was established at the beginning of the 19th century as a road connecting Częstochowa and Nowa Częstochowa, cities administratively connected on August 19, 1826. Currently, it connects the Old Town of Częstochowa, Śródmieście and the Podjasnogórska district.
The avenue is characterized by a structure in which two two-lane roadways are separated by a boulevard running between them. During the pilgrimage period, it is used by pilgrims heading for the Jasna Góra monastery. Among the inhabitants of Częstochowa, there is a traditional division into three independent parts (Avenue I, Avenue II and Avenue III).

Władysław Biegański Square

Highlight • Monument

One of the squares in the center of Częstochowa, lying on the pilgrimage road to Jasna Góra, dividing the Avenue of the Holy Virgin Mary into the so-called "Second avenue" - east of the square, and "third avenue" - west of it.
In the years 1828–1836, in the southern part of the square, according to a design by Franciszek Reinstein, a town hall was erected along with a guardhouse and a detention facility which no longer exists. It was built halfway between Old and New Częstochowa.
In 1908 it was rebuilt. Late-Classicist, multi-storey with a round two-storey tower.
It was the seat of the city authorities until the 1960s, now - along with the guardianship - it belongs to the Częstochowa Museum.
In 1875 a tenement house was built here, now called Popówka.
In the years 1892–1926 there was a power plant at the back of the town hall.

Old Market Square in Częstochowa

Highlight • Monument

In the Middle Ages, the Old Market Square served as the market square of Old Częstochowa.

The buildings in the market square were burned down during the Swedish invasion.

Townhouses on the eastern and northern sides of the square remain preserved. From the 15th century to 1812, the town hall stood here, but was destroyed by fire. According to legend, Napoleon Bonaparte spent the night in the inn at the Old Market Square on his way to Moscow with his troops.

In 2007, archaeological excavations began in the market square. These led to the discovery of the city well, the foundations of several no longer existing buildings, likely the city scales, and a gallows.

Balancing Sculptures by Jerzy Kędziora
The entire project is complemented by original balancing sculptures in the form of a "theater." This is undoubtedly one of the main attractions of the square's new arrangement. There are 14 sculptures, forming several thematic groups of figures.


The group of sculptures forms a collection dubbed "Teatrum – Igrce Częstocha" by the author. This is the largest exhibition of works by Częstochowa artist Jerzy Kędziora in an urban setting, and it can now finally be fully admired.

Jasna Gora Monastery

Highlight • Religious Site

The Jasna Góra Monastery is the most important Catholic pilgrimage center in Poland and one of the most important sites of Marian devotion. It is a sanctuary and a monastery of the Pauline Order in one. It is a building and a place with a colossal history, and since 1994, it has been a historical monument. The fortified hill 296.6 towering over the north-west part of Częstochowa was one of the key defense points of the "North" section in the "Częstochowa" position, also known as the Częstochowa redoubt. In addition, the hill was also an excellent vantage point for Polish artillery observers, with a view stretching as far as Lgotha and Libidza. The possible conquest of the hill could therefore give the Germans a perfect insight into the center of the Polish grouping and, consequently, the possibility of breaking the first line of defense of the 27th Infantry Regiment.

Frequently Asked Questions

What historical sites can I explore in and around Gmina Rędziny?

Gmina Rędziny and its surroundings offer a rich historical tapestry. Within the gmina, you can visit the 19th-century brick manor house at the Kościelec Manor Complex, the remains of the Konin Manor Complex, and the neo-Gothic brick church in Rędziny village. Nearby, in Częstochowa, don't miss the highly significant Jasna Gora Monastery, a historical monument and major pilgrimage site. Other notable historical locations include the Old Market Square in Częstochowa, known for its preserved townhouses and balancing sculptures, and Reduta Częstochowa – Hill 296.6, a fortified hill with an observation bunker that served as a key defensive position.

Are there any natural features or outdoor points of interest in Gmina Rędziny?

Yes, Gmina Rędziny features several natural and outdoor points of interest. The Kamieniołom Lipówka (Lipówka Quarry) is noted as a place worth seeing. While the gmina is largely agricultural, with over 70% of its area dedicated to farming, it also offers appealing landscapes for outdoor enthusiasts. Additionally, Lotnisko Rudniki (Rudniki Airport) is a local point of interest.
